My keyboard does not type correctly

(Click here to view the original thread with full colors/images)


Posted by: rangarajuk

When I type on my key board, when I type "m" it types "0" and when type "j" it types "1" and when I type "o" it types "6" etc. I am not able to change it. What is wrong with my Laptop? It is IBM Think Pad T42 and on XP Professional.

Any help is appreciated



Posted by: matt.modica

You have the NumLock turned on. When I looked at your post, I noticed it is the exactly the same for my computer. To turn the NumLock off, press the NumLk key at the top of the keyboard. This is a perfectly normal feature of your keyboard so don't worry.
